Opening its doors officially later in summer 2026, after a major refurbishment and multi-year program of investment, we are looking forward to our brand new national museum. 

It will be celebrating our long proud history of football, with the Welsh Football Association being founded here in Wrexham exactly 150 years ago.

Also fondly known as the 'Museum of two halves' - giving both a nod to its dual purpose and to the great game itself, our new museum will celebrate the people, the history of Wrexham and its national importance as the ancestral home of football in Wales.

The original building was built in 1855 and has long been a familiar sight in Wrexham and recently from 1996 served as Wrexham's local museum. 

With the planned celebrations in 2026 celebrating 150 years of the Welsh FA, the site has undergone an extensive redevelopment program, to bring it up to national standards, and offering visitors to Wrexham a great new destination to learn more about our amazing local and national history.

We look forward to sharing more as and when the museum officially opens.
